The Hard Problem Isn’t Agent Identity; It’s Agent Authority
AI agents are not simply another form of automation. Traditional software generally executes predetermined instructions. An agent may be asked to interpret an objective, choose among possible actions and adapt when circumstances change.
The week’s funding news shows how healthcare AI is beginning to operate inside workflows where software must interpret rules, gather evidence, communicate with counterparties, resolve exceptions and sometimes determine what should happen next. A binary permission such as agent permitted or agent denied is almost useless in that environment. Authority has to become contextual.
Consider a corporate procurement agent told to replenish inventory without interrupting production. Authenticating that agent does little to determine whether it can select a new supplier, accept a price increase, modify quantities, negotiate payment terms, exceed a department budget or initiate payment. Each decision could require a different level of delegated authority.
As a result, the competitive center of B2B software is beginning to shift toward permission architecture. Enterprises already encode authority throughout their systems. ERP platforms contain budgets and cost centers, procurement applications maintain approved-vendor rules, corporate cards enforce spending limits, contracts establish commercial boundaries and identity systems define organizational roles. Those controls look less like administrative bureaucracy and more like today’s raw material for machine-readable governance.

The Transaction Is Becoming a Chain of Authority
Healthcare offers another useful lesson because the difficult part of automation is often not processing the normal case. It is governing the exception. An agent handling a straightforward workflow can follow established rules. But enterprise value often depends on what happens when those rules collide with reality.
Human organizations handle these situations through judgment and escalation. Agentic systems will need a machine-readable equivalent.
That suggests the next generation of payment controls may move beyond static limits such as “this card can spend $10,000.” A company might instead specify that an agent can autonomously transact with approved suppliers up to a certain amount, tolerate price variance within a defined range and modify shipping terms when the expected cost of delay exceeds the premium.

There is also a final lesson healthcare can offer finance: autonomous systems need to leave evidence behind. Healthcare already operates in a world where administrative decisions can require documentation connecting information, policies, communications and outcomes.
Agentic payments may have to adopt the same logic.
